Summary
The sermon discusses the five phases of salvation, emphasizing the practical phase as the believer's responsibility to grow in faith after being born again. It distinguishes between regeneration and conversion, using biblical examples such as the Ethiopian eunuch and Cornelius to illustrate true faith and the process of salvation. The preacher highlights the importance of understanding predestination, legal justification through Christ's sacrifice, and the necessity of baptism as a public confession of faith. The message encourages believers to reveal Christ and live out their faith practically.
